Selective Formation of a Single Atropisomer of meso–meso‐Linked ZnII Diporphyrin through Supramolecular Self‐Assembly
Abstract
One‐way atropisomerism: meso‐(4‐Butoxypyrid‐3‐yl)‐substituted ZnII porphyrins self‐assemble to form zigzag‐shaped cyclic hexamers, whereas the meso–meso‐linked ZnII diporphyrins 1 undergo self‐sorting self‐assembly to form different assemblies. Upon heating, entropically driven one‐way atropisomerism to 1in−in has been achieved through fragmentary reconstitution of supramolecular aggregates.
